The remap command allows to change the definition of the turtlebot_teleop_keyboard/cmd_vel to the topic defined in the turtlebot robot. By default TurtleBot works with Logitech joysticks but theres a gotcha they use a deadman button which must be held down at all times while operating the joystick, otherwise nothing will happen.
